summaryrefslogtreecommitdiffstats
path: root/Lib/test/test_bytes.py
diff options
context:
space:
mode:
authorSerhiy Storchaka <storchaka@gmail.com>2019-02-19 11:49:09 (GMT)
committerGitHub <noreply@github.com>2019-02-19 11:49:09 (GMT)
commit8e79e6e56f516385ccb761e407dfff3a39253180 (patch)
tree288fe0464276f9f8efb96556c1dee35766e3a089 /Lib/test/test_bytes.py
parente7a4bb554edb72fc6619d23241d59162d06f249a (diff)
downloadcpython-8e79e6e56f516385ccb761e407dfff3a39253180.zip
cpython-8e79e6e56f516385ccb761e407dfff3a39253180.tar.gz
cpython-8e79e6e56f516385ccb761e407dfff3a39253180.tar.bz2
Fix syntax warnings in tests introduced in bpo-15248. (GH-11932)
Diffstat (limited to 'Lib/test/test_bytes.py')
-rw-r--r--Lib/test/test_bytes.py8
1 files changed, 5 insertions, 3 deletions
diff --git a/Lib/test/test_bytes.py b/Lib/test/test_bytes.py
index f7454d9..a091360 100644
--- a/Lib/test/test_bytes.py
+++ b/Lib/test/test_bytes.py
@@ -852,9 +852,10 @@ class BytesTest(BaseBytesTest, unittest.TestCase):
type2test = bytes
def test_getitem_error(self):
+ b = b'python'
msg = "byte indices must be integers or slices"
with self.assertRaisesRegex(TypeError, msg):
- b'python'['a']
+ b['a']
def test_buffer_is_readonly(self):
fd = os.open(__file__, os.O_RDONLY)
@@ -1042,14 +1043,15 @@ class ByteArrayTest(BaseBytesTest, unittest.TestCase):
type2test = bytearray
def test_getitem_error(self):
+ b = bytearray(b'python')
msg = "bytearray indices must be integers or slices"
with self.assertRaisesRegex(TypeError, msg):
- bytearray(b'python')['a']
+ b['a']
def test_setitem_error(self):
+ b = bytearray(b'python')
msg = "bytearray indices must be integers or slices"
with self.assertRaisesRegex(TypeError, msg):
- b = bytearray(b'python')
b['a'] = "python"
def test_nohash(self):